Sustainable Energy Youth Network Sustainable Energy Youth Network (SEYN) wants to empower young people to actively contribute to the energy transition movement towards a fossil-fuel-free era. SEYN aims to sensitize and motivate mainly young people to the challenges of climate change and the necessity of developing sustainable means of energy production by the local communities, which can contribute to the preservation of the biodiversity of the planet and to promote a social cooperative model of human development.
